  1. Click ‘Get Form’ to open the Colorado Appeal Court document in the editor.
  2. Begin by entering the Defendant/Appellant's name in the designated field. Ensure that all information is accurate and complete.
  3. Fill in the 'Case Number' and 'Citation Number' fields. These are crucial for identifying your case within the court system.
  4. Provide your contact information, including phone numbers and email address, to ensure you can be reached regarding your appeal.
  5. In the 'NOTICE OF APPEAL AND DESIGNATION OF RECORD' section, clearly state your reasons for appeal. Be concise yet thorough.
  6. If applicable, indicate whether you request a stay of execution by checking the appropriate box and understanding any conditions attached.
  7. Complete the 'Current information about the Defendant/Appellant' section with full name, mailing address, and phone numbers.
  8. Designate what records you want included in your appeal by checking relevant items under 'Designation of Record'.
  9. Finally, sign and date the form at the bottom. If an attorney is involved, they should also provide their signature.

Tenth Circuit | The United States Court of Appeals.
February 28, 1929 The act divided the Eighth Circuit into two circuits, reorganizing the judicial districts of Arkansas, Iowa, Minnesota, Missouri, Nebraska, North Dakota, and South Dakota as a new Eighth Circuit and Colorado, Kansas, New Mexico, Oklahoma, Utah, and Wyoming as the Tenth Circuit.
After a Decision is Issued Step 1: File the Notice of Appeal. Step 2: Pay the filing fee. Step 3: Determine if/when additional information must be provided to the appeals court as part of opening your case. Step 4: Order the trial transcripts. Step 5: Confirm that the record has been transferred to the appellate court.
About the Colorado Court of Appeals The Court sits in three-member divisions to decide cases. The Chief Judge, appointed by the Chief Justice of the Supreme Court, assigns judges to the divisions and rotates their assignments.
Tenth Circuit Court of Appeals. The United States Court of Appeals for the Tenth Circuit is based in the Byron White U.S. Courthouse in Denver, Colorado.
